What is an overnight PRN RN?

An Overnight PRN RN is a registered nurse who works as needed (PRN, or 'pro re nata') during overnight shifts, rather than having a regular, set schedule. These nurses fill in for staff shortages or increased patient needs, often covering night shifts in hospitals, clinics, or long-term care facilities. The PRN status gives them flexibility in choosing shifts, but work hours can vary depending on the employer’s staffing requirements. They are responsible for providing patient care, administering medications, and monitoring patient status during nighttime hours.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an overnight PRN RN?

To thrive as an Overnight PRN RN, you need a current RN license, solid clinical skills, and experience in acute or long-term care settings. Familiarity with electronic health records (EHRs), medication administration systems, and shift-reporting tools is critical. Strong organizational skills, adaptability, and the ability to work independently are important soft skills for managing patient care during night shifts. These qualifications ensure safe, efficient, and consistent patient care, even during off-hours when resources may be limited.

What are some common challenges faced by overnight PRN RNs, and how can they be managed?

Overnight PRN RNs often encounter challenges such as adjusting to irregular sleep schedules, managing limited onsite resources, and handling urgent situations with reduced staff. To manage these, it's important to establish a consistent sleep routine, communicate effectively with the day team during shift changes, and stay organized to prioritize patient care efficiently. Collaborating closely with the on-call team and leveraging available protocols can also help ensure quality care during overnight hours.
